Assistant VDC Manager
CategoryConstruction Operations
LocationWilmington, NC
Position TypeFull-Time/Regular
Job DescriptionWhiting-Turner is looking for a self-motivated, collaborative, and confident individual with a minimum of 2 years of experience leading multi-discipline BIM coordination efforts for either a Subcontractor or General Contractor. Work experience in the Federal sector is strongly preferred. The individual will be expected to manage the Virtual Building process for multiple projects.
This individual will lead various project teams in the execution of a Virtual Building program. They will also be tasked with leveraging BIM and other emerging technologies to promote VDC adoption within Whiting-Turner's Federal portfolio.
Qualified Candidates should- Be proficient in reading and understanding construction drawings and interpreting construction schedules.
- Have an intermediate knowledge of Mechanical, Electrical, Plumbing and Fire Protection systems.
- Be adept in coordination management software used to aggregate BIMs and run conflict detection.
- Thrive in a team environment contributing to both large projects and producing independent work.
- Have an innately curious, forward-thinking personality to push innovative ideas in all aspects of daily tasks.
- Be able to multi-task and work concurrently on multiple projects.
- Reviewing RFPs and specifications for BIM requirements.
- Developing BIM Execution Plans.
- Evaluating Design Intent models for constructability and accuracy.
- Creating virtual simulations to validate and improve site logistics, safety concerns, building sequencing, and scheduling.
- Developing BIM scope language for BIM participating trade partners.
- Leading collaborative meetings with trade partners and designers to resolve above ceiling conflicts using virtual models.
- Producing clash reports and action items for distribution to all BIM stakeholders.
- Assisting with Virtual mock-ups and gap modeling specific systems.
- Generating and tracking RFIs resulting from the Virtual Build Process.
- Developing composite shop drawing submittals.
- Testing new software programs and technologies and making recommendations on use for project-specific needs.
- Excellent General Computing Skills
- Advanced knowledge of Autodesk products including but not limited to:
- Revit
- AutoCAD
- Navisworks Manage
- Experience with cloud-based common data environments such as Sharepoint and Autodesk Forma and Desktop Connector
- Knowledge of BIM issue tracking software such as BIM Collaborate and Revizto.
- Experience with 4D Scheduling Tools (Synchro, Fuzor or similar)
- Excellent written and oral communication skills
- Ability to work well with cross-discipline teams
- Skilled at problem solving
- Strong Time-Management skills
- Leadership fundamentals
- Bachelor's degree with preference given to Architectural, Civil Engineering, or Construction Management related degrees or associate degrees in a VDC/BIM technical concentration.
- 2 or more years of relevant work experience in the AEC industry in a BIM Management role or other relevant field experience on Federal construction projects.
